Erreur 500 récurrentes sur plusieurs applis

Bonjour,

Régulièrement, plusieurs applis, toujours les mêmes, arrêtent de fonctionner et me renvoien une erreur HTTP 500. Il s’agit de Nextcloud, Opensondage, ttrss et wallabag, les autres applis ainsi que le serveur mail étant encore fonctionnelles. En général, un redémarrage suffit à corriger le tout, mais ça finit toujours par revenir, et tant qu’à faire, j’aimerais que ça ne se reproduise plus.

Arf oui c’est un peu embettant…

Là comme ça, je pense pas qu’on puisse trop t’aider, mais je pense que pour démystifier le truc, il faudrait aller voir un peu les logs quand le probleme survient.

Si tu es à l’aise avec la ligne de commande, par exemple :

  • aller dans le dossier des logs nginx avec cd /var/log/nginx
  • faire un ls -thor pour voir les fichiers récemment modifiés (juste après avoir rencontré l’erreur 500)
  • apriori le fichier contenant l’erreur devrait se finir en -error.log
  • afficher les quelques lignes à la fin du fichier avec genre tail -n 50 lefichier-error.log

et là dedans on devrait pouvoir avoir un début d’explication peut-être…

OK. J’ai examiné les logs, et une ligne semble correspondre à l’erreur.

2018/04/02 20:46:12 [crit] 876#0: *1784 SSL_do_handshake() failed (SSL: error:140A1175:SSL routines:SSL_BYTES_TO_CIPHER_LIST:inappropriate fallback) while SSL handshaking, client: 185.104.186.203, server: 0.0.0.0:443

Après, j’en sais rien, parce que pour moi, c’est du chinois.